Raimo Lehtomaa:
Basic Patterns
Arabianranta Library is displaying Raimo Lehtomaa's exhibition Basic Patterns from June 3 to July 31, 2026. You are warmly welcome to view the works!
The works often consist of thin, translucent layers of color that blend into each other. The image surface is divided into several parts, where dark-light contrast, broken tones and the interaction of colors alternate.
The images are created subconsciously. They contain figures or creatures, shapes reminiscent of organic and human reality, but without being too clear references to the surrounding reality.
Raimo Lehtomaa is a Helsinki-based visual artist who has studied at the Kankaanpää Art School and the Lahti Institute of Design. The techniques most often used are acrylic painting, ink and mixed media. He has held numerous solo exhibitions and participated in dozens of group exhibitions in Finland and abroad.
